Entry requirements

For MSc entry, a good relevant Honours degree (first or second class) or equivalent overseas qualifications will be considered. Given the clear practical element of the programmes, we will also consider non-graduate candidates holding less than a good Honours degree, or its equivalent, but with compensating qualifications or experience may be admitted to the Postgraduate Diploma programme. Transfer to the MSc will be possible later on if exams and course work are at MSc level.

English language requirements

Where English was not the medium of instruction at secondary school, applicants must demonstrate English language proficiency equivalent to IELTS 6.5 (with all elements passed at 6.0 or above). Applicants who have completed secondary and tertiary education will need to provide documentary evidence. A minimum of one year full-time study in English will be required.

Course content

This Master's in Design Management programme has been developed for those already within a creative industry who are looking to gain core and relevant skills of business and management, as well as those in an established business environment looking to gain experience and knowledge in developing creative strategies.

Graduates will develop the knowledge to produce insightful projects and instigate problem-solving across all departments and stakeholders that support the product in areas of services, communications, technology, and brand entity.

Why study Design Management at Heriot-Watt University's Dubai Campus?

Design Management enables an organisation to confidently deliver innovative business strategy whilst producing innovatively designed products through creative teams and creative problem-solving.

It allows individuals to develop productive working cultures whilst remaining focused on the customer and staff journey, enabling businesses to acquire the strategy goals via effective design. It blends creativity, innovation, entrepreneurship and management.

Design Management develops skills for graduates, managers and executives responsible for making decisions about how design is used in the organisation for product development and associated departments.
